11 One day Jesus was in a place talking with God. When he had finished, one of his disciples said to him, `Lord, teach us to talk with God as John taught his disciples.'
2 Jesus said, `When you talk with God, say, "Our Father in heaven, may your name be kept holy. May your kingdom come.
3 Give us our food day by day.
4 Forgive us for the wrong things we have done. We forgive everyone who has done wrong to us. Do not lead us to be tested." '
5 Jesus said to them, `Maybe one of you has a friend. You go to him in the middle of the night and say to him, "Friend, lend me three loaves of bread.
6 A friend has come to my house. He has been on the road. I have no food to give him to eat."
7 `Maybe the friend in the house answers you and says, "Do not trouble me. The door is locked. And my children and I are in bed. I cannot get up and give you anything."
8 I tell you this. Maybe he will not give him anything because he is his friend. But he will get up and give him what he needs because he keeps on asking for it.
9 `And I tell you, ask and you will get what you ask for. Look and you will find what you look for. Knock and the door will be opened for you.
10 Everyone who asks will get. The one who looks will find. And the one who knocks will have the door opened for him.
11 Which of you fathers will give your son a snake if he asks for a fish?
12 Will you give him a scorpion [an insect with a sting] if he asks for an egg?
13 You are wrong and yet you know how to give good things to your children. Much more, the Father in heaven will give the Holy Spirit to those who ask him.'
14 Jesus was driving a bad spirit out of a man who could not talk. When the spirit left him, the man could talk. The people were surprised.
15 But some of them said, `This man drives out bad spirits by the help of Beelzebub, the chief of bad spirits.'
16 Other people wanted to test Jesus. They asked him to show them a sign from heaven.
17 But Jesus knew what they were thinking. So he said, `If one part of any country fights against the other part of the country, that country is spoiled. And if one part of any family fights against the other part of the family, it cannot stand.
18 If Satan fights against himself, how will his kingdom stand? You say I drive out bad spirits by the help of Beelzebub.
19 If I drive out bad spirits by the help of Beelzebub, by whose help do your own people drive them out? Your own people will judge you for this!
20 But if I drive out bad spirits by the help of God, then know this, God's kingdom is here with you now.
21 `A strong man has something in his hand to fight. He guards his place. He will not lose his things.
22 But when a stronger man comes, he catches the man who guards his house. He will take away what is in the man's hand. And he will take his things and give them to his friends.
23 `Anyone who is not with me is against me. Anyone who does not work with me, works against me.'
24 `When a bad spirit has gone out of a man, he goes through dry places. He looks for a place to rest, but he does not find any. Then he says, "I will go back to my house from where I came."
25 `When he comes back, he finds it clean and all fixed up.
26 Then he goes and brings seven other spirits who are worse than he is. They go in and live there. Now the man is worse than he was at first.'
27 As he said this, a woman among the people called out, `Happy is your mother who gave birth to you, and fed you as a baby.'
28 But Jesus said, `Happy are those who hear God's word and obey it!'
29 More and more people were coming. He started to talk. He said, `People today are bad. They want a sign. No sign will be given them but the sign of Jonah the prophet of God.
30 Jonah was a sign to the men in the city of Nineveh. In the same way the Son of Man will be a sign to the people today.
31 When the people are judged, the Queen from the South will stand up and speak against men who live today. She came a long way to hear the wise words of Solomon. The one who is here is greater than Solomon.
32 When people are judged, the men of Nineveh will stand up and speak against the people of today. They stopped their wrong ways when Jonah told them God's word. And the one who is here is greater than Jonah.'
33 `No person lights a lamp and hides it in a hole or puts it under a basket. But he puts it on a place for a lamp. Then people who come in can see the light.
34 Your body gets its light through your eyes. When you have good eyes, all your body has light. But when your eyes are bad, your body is in darkness.
35 So be sure that it is not dark in you where it should be light.
36 If no part of your body is dark, it will all be light. It will be like a lamp that shines to give you light.'
37 While Jesus was saying these things, a Pharisee asked him to come to eat at his house. So Jesus went in and sat at the table.
38 The Pharisee saw that Jesus did not wash his hands before he ate. He was surprised.
39 The Lord said to him, `You Pharisees wash the outside of a cup and a dish clean. But inside you are full of greed and wrong ways.
40 You are fools! Did not God make the outside and inside also?
41 Do good, and do it from your heart. Then everything is clean for you.
42 `You Pharisees will have trouble! You give to God a tenth part of small garden plants. But you do not judge in the right way. And you do not love God. You should do these things and the other things too.
43 `You Pharisees will have trouble! In the meeting houses you want to sit in the front seats. And in the market you want people to greet you.
44 You will have trouble! You are not true to yourselves! You are like graves that are not marked. Men walk over them and do not know it.'
45 Then one of the men who taught God's law said to Jesus, `Teacher, when you say these things, you talk against us too.'
46 Jesus said, `You men will have trouble also! You put heavy loads on people's backs. But you yourselves will not put up one finger to help carry the loads.
47 You will have trouble! You build places to bury the prophets of God that your fathers killed.
48 In this way you show you agree to the things your fathers did. They killed the prophets, and you build places to bury them.
49 That is why God, who is wise, said, "I will send prophets and messengers to them. They will kill some of them. And they will trouble some of them."
50 So the people who are living now will be punished for all the blood of the prophets of God that is on the ground since the world was made.
51 I mean all the blood from the time of Abel to the time of Zechariah. (He was killed between the holy table and the temple.) Yes, I tell you. The people who are living now will be punished for all of it.
52 `You teachers of God's law will have trouble! You have taken away the key of the door where people can go in and know what is true. You yourselves did not go in, and you stopped those who were going in.'
53 When Jesus left the house, the scribes and Pharisees began to be very angry with him. They asked him questions about many things.
54 They wanted him to say something that was wrong so they could make trouble for him.
12 Now, my Christian brothers, I want you to know something about the gifts given by the Holy Spirit.
2 You know that before you believed in God, you were led by other men to believe in idols that could not talk.
3 Therefore, I want you to understand this. No person who has the Spirit of God ever curses Jesus. And no one can say, `Jesus is Lord,' if he is not controlled by the Holy Spirit.
4 There are different gifts, but there is only one Spirit.
5 There are different kinds of work, but there is only one Lord.
6 There are different ways of working, but there is only one God. He works in all people and does it all.
7 And the Holy Spirit gives each one a gift so that all people may be helped.
8 The Spirit gives one person wise words to say. The same Spirit gives another person words of good understanding.
9 To another person the same Spirit gives faith, and to another person he gives the power to heal people.
10 To another person the Spirit gives the power to do big works. Another can speak words from God. To another person he gives the power to know the difference between spirits. To another person he gives the gift to speak the words of God in other tongues or languages, and to another the meaning of these different tongues.
11 And the same Spirit gives the power for all these things. He gives each person what he wants to give to them.
12 A person has only one body, and the body has many parts. It is the same with Christ.
13 The one Spirit baptized us all to make one body. It made no difference whether we were Jews or Greeks, whether we were slaves or free men. We were all given to drink of one Spirit.
14 I say again, the body is not all one part, but has many parts.
15 Perhaps the foot says, `I am not the hand, so I do not belong to the body.' But it is still a part of the body.
16 Perhaps the ear says, `I am not the eye, so I do not belong to the body.' But it is still a part of the body.
17 If all of the body were an eye, how could we hear? If all the body were an ear, how could we smell?
18 The way it is now, God has put each part in the body in the place he wanted it.
19 If they were all one part, how could it be a body?
20 The way it is now, there are many parts, but it is one body.
21 The eye cannot say to the hand, `I do not need you.' And the head cannot say to the feet, `I do not need you.'
22 No, that is not so. Some parts of the body are not as strong as others. Yet we could not live without them.
23 And we look after some parts of our body more than others because they need it. The parts of our body that are not so fine in one way are made more fine in other ways. But the parts which are fine already do not need to be made fine. God made the body and has given more care to the parts that need it.
24 He did this so that the body would not be divided into groups, but all the parts would help each other. 26 ) If one part has trouble, then all the other parts are troubled too. If one part is praised, then all the other parts are glad with it.
25 Now, all of you together are the body of Christ, and each one of you is a part of it.
26 God has given each person their right place in the church. First, there are the apostles. Second, there are prophets who speak words from God. Third, there are those who teach. Then there are those who do big works. Then there are those who have the gifts to heal people, those who help in the work of the church people, those who lead and guide others, and those who speak God's words in different kinds of tongues or languages.
27 Are all the people apostles? Can they all speak words from God? Can they all teach? Can they all do big works?
28 Do they all have the gifts to heal the sick people? Can they all speak in different tongues? Can they all tell the meaning of these tongues?
29 You should seek after the best gifts. But I will show you a way that is much better than any of them!
